Headbolt Lane station is equipped with a comprehensive range of facilities to make your travel experience smooth and efficient. The ticket office is open from as early as 05:33 until midnight, ensuring you have ample opportunity to purchase and collect tickets at your convenience. For added ease, ticket machines are also accessible, including those designed for disability access.
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access available throughout the station. Those with reduced mobility will find acc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and accessible toilets. Helpful staff are available from early morning to late night to assist you every step of the way. And for your peace of mind, the station is monitored by CCTV.
Seamlessly linked to the Merseyrail network, Headbolt Lane station serves as a convenient hub for onward journeys. If you're planning to head to Liverpool John Lennon Airport, you can easily book a combined train and bus ticket right at the station. Local buses also connect you to various routes, ensuring you have plenty of options to reach your final destination. At Woodmansterne Station, you'll find a range of amenities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. While the ticket office opens weekdays from 06:10 to 10:40, rest assured that there are automated ticket machines ready to serve you outside these hours. For added convenience, you can collect tickets bought online directly from the station's ticket machines. Smartcard users will be pleased to know that smartcard validators are available, ensuring a swift passage through the station.
In terms of accessibility, Woodmansterne might present some challenges as it does not have step-free access, so plan accordingly if mobility is a concern. Helpful station staff are on hand during specific hours on weekdays, ready to assist with any queries or needs you might have. Despite the absence of waiting rooms, there is seating available for travelers on the platform.
If you're cycling to the station, there are 10 secure bicycle stands sheltered and monitored by CCTV to ensure your bike's safety while you travel. While there are no on-site shops or refreshment facilities to speak of, the station provides an ATM for any quick cash needs you may have.
Beyond the tracks, Woodmansterne Station connects you to broader transport routes. For those needing bus services, detailed onward travel information and maps are available at the station. This makes planning your journey beyond the train a seamless experience.
